COMAND question

I want the hands free feature in the 55, and am in the process of working with Steve on the install, but I have a question. What are the COMAND features? I really only want the hands free phone feature, but am uncertain as to what I might be missing if I opt for only the phone install and not the COMAND. Is COMAND really only Nav?

Also, on the hands free phones, are most using the UHI supported phones? If so, or not, for what reasons?

Comand is not 'only' nav. It's radio as well, and if you have a factory fitted CD changer, it can be controlled from the comand unit also...

The COMAND unit also has a single CD player in it (for the Navigation CD's), in case you don't have a 6-disc CD changer - or it's disconnected (I had to have mine disconnected to have Steve install my ice>Link: Plus iPod adapter). I haven't actually tried to use it as a CD player (it always has a Navigation CD in its belly) but I assume it can still play regular audio CD's
